And the drinks and food fit the space perfectly. The whole package works,\u201d he said.<\/p>\n<p>Gorst and Nelson were among a group of us that turned out for a friend\u2019s 50th birthday party recently, held beneath panels of skylights in the tavern\u2019s quaint backroom, which features reprinted pages of The New York Times dating back to the 1930s as wallpaper. A close look at some of the advertisements reveal women\u2019s coats selling for under $4 and cigarettes going for 35 cents a pack.<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_22611\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-22611\" style=\"width: 275px\" class=\"wp-caption alignleft\"><a href=\"https:\/\/sduptownnews.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2015\/09\/Uptown-Tavern-martiniweb.jpg\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-22611 lazyload\" data-src=\"https:\/\/sduptownnews.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2015\/09\/Uptown-Tavern-martiniweb.jpg\" alt=\"A martini served at Uptown Tavern during happy hour (Photo by Dr. Ink)\" width=\"275\" height=\"367\" src=\"data:image\/gif;base64,R0lGODlhAQABAAAAACH5BAEKAAEALAAAAAABAAEAAAICTAEAOw==\" style=\"--smush-placeholder-width: 275px; --smush-placeholder-aspect-ratio: 275\/367;\" \/><\/a><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-22611\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">A martini served at Uptown Tavern during happy hour (Photo by Dr. Ink)<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p>For those of us who arrived before 7 p.m., all drinks were 50 percent cheaper than normal, except for bottles of wine, the tavern\u2019s big, boozy \u201cfishbowls\u201d and one particular draft beer of a label I can\u2019t remember. Otherwise, you name it, and you got it.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cEven top shelf gin?\u201d I asked the socially polished bartender when inquiring about the price of a Bombay Sapphire martini with three olives tossed in.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cYes, we bring it down halfway,\u201d he replied suggestively.<\/p>\n<p>And so there I was, throwing back two of the martinis for only $5.40 apiece before they rose to full price. To no surprise, I later learned that each contained traditional two-ounce pours of the gin. Hence, my initial greeting to the birthday girl was rather loud and sloppy.<\/p>\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/sduptownnews.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2015\/09\/Screen-Shot-2015-09-10-at-3.03.12-PM.png\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ignright wp-image-22614 lazyload\" data-src=\"https:\/\/sduptownnews.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2015\/09\/Screen-Shot-2015-09-10-at-3.03.12-PM.png\" alt=\"Screen Shot 2015-09-10 at 3.03.12 PM\" width=\"175\" height=\"556\" src=\"data:image\/gif;base64,R0lGODlhAQABAAAAACH5BAEKAAEALAAAAAABAAEAAAICTAEAOw==\" style=\"--smush-placeholder-width: 175px; --smush-placeholder-aspect-ratio: 175\/556;\" \/><\/a>The friend I arrived with managed to throw down a glass of well-structured Josh Cabernet from the Central Coast ($5) and a pint of Wipeout by Port Brewery ($3.25) before happy hour ended. He was content on both counts.<\/p>\n<p>For those in our group arriving only minutes before drinks switched to full price, the bartender jumped into high-speed mode in order to accommodate them. We were impressed.<\/p>\n<p>If you\u2019ve never tried Uptown\u2019s five-spice wings, you\u2019re missing some of the best in San Diego. They\u2019re crispier than most and glazed judiciously in a tantalizing sweet-chili sauce.
